Other core interventions to be delivered over the next 14 months HSS issues: –Improving utilization of ANC services –Recruiting and training community health workers –Community systems strengthening –Expand HR capacity Recruitment at all levels TAs from Partners and Private-Publication Partnership –Coordination:

Challenges Delayed disbursement of Global Fund Round IV phase 2 Rejection of Global Fund Round 9 proposal Consequences of above: –Impending ACT stock out from Dec 2009 –No universal coverage by LLINs –Failure to achieve country RBM targets

Summary of rate-limiting factors over the next 14 months Funding gap for commodities –LLINs –IRS –RDTs –IEC/BCC –M&E Procurement bottlenecks –Long processes, –Delayed disbursements from Global Funds Human resource needs –M&E –Logistics –Planning and coordination
